What it is

Retatrutide, code LY3437943, is a 39 amino acid synthetic peptide that activates three receptors: the glucose-dependent insulinotropic polypeptide receptor, the GLP-1 receptor and the glucagon receptor. A C20 fatty diacid on a lysine side chain binds albumin, giving a half life of about six days. Eli Lilly developed it. It is approved nowhere in the world.

Mechanism, and what the GIP arm actually does

In vitro the half maximal effective concentrations are 0.0643 nanomolar at the GIP receptor, 0.775 at the GLP-1 receptor and 5.79 at the glucagon receptor, roughly 12 times more potent at GIP than at GLP-1 and 90 times more than at glucagon. Against the native hormones it is 0.3 times as active as glucagon, 0.4 times as active as GLP-1 and 8.9 times as potent as native GIP.

Calling it a balanced triple agonist misreads the sponsor’s own sentence, which reads balanced GCGR and GLP-1R activity but more GIPR activity. Balanced covers two receptors and explicitly exempts the third.

The GIP arm is agonism, not blockade, and the most potent of the three. Why that helps is not known: Rosenkilde and colleagues report benefits from both GIP receptor antagonism and agonism, with the mechanism of the paradox unknown. No human study has isolated the GIP contribution inside retatrutide.

The 24.2 percent figure, and the word doing the work in it

It comes from a phase 2 trial of 338 adults with obesity and without type 2 diabetes, seven arms, 48 weeks. The 12 mg arm showed a least squares mean weight reduction of 24.2 percent against 2.1 percent on placebo, a secondary endpoint. The primary endpoint, at 24 weeks, was 17.5 percent.

It is also an efficacy estimand, which is where most weight loss claims come apart. That analysis keeps every randomised participant but discards data collected after a person permanently stops the drug, then models the rest as though they had stayed on. It is not a completer analysis, which restricts to those who finished, and not intention to treat, which keeps the post-discontinuation data. It answers how much weight people lose while taking the drug, not how much a population loses if you start them all on it.

Phase 3 quantifies the gap. In TRIUMPH-1 at week 80 the 12 mg arm was 28.3 percent on the efficacy estimand and 25.0 on the treatment regimen estimand, 3.3 points apart, while placebo moved the other way, 2.2 against 3.9 percent. The effect against placebo is therefore 26.1 points on one analysis and 21.1 on the other, about 5 points from the choice of analysis alone.

Both 28.3 and 30.3 percent circulate as the TRIUMPH-1 result. Both are real and describe different things. The 28.3 percent is the week 80 efficacy estimand for the 12 mg arm, all 2,339 randomised participants. The 30.3 percent is a week 104 figure from an extension of 532 people with a BMI of 35 or more at week zero who completed 80 weeks without discontinuing or reducing dose, a group selected for having tolerated the full dose that long.

The phase 3 programme, and what a press release is worth

The programme is larger than it looks: TRIUMPH-1 through TRIUMPH-9, plus TRIUMPH-Outcomes, a 10,000 participant cardiovascular and kidney outcomes trial reporting in 2029, plus a separate TRANSCEND programme in type 2 diabetes and chronic kidney disease. TRIUMPH-9, 600 participants over 104 weeks, exists solely to find the best dose escalation scheme and reports in October 2028.

That settles something. Every week by week titration table in circulation presents itself as a protocol, yet the sponsor, holding all of its own data, does not know which scheme is best and is running a two year trial to find out. All that is published about phase 3 escalation is that it is fixed, lasts 16 weeks and ends at 4, 9 or 12 mg.

Every phase 3 obesity figure in circulation is a press release figure. TRIUMPH-4, 445 people, knee osteoarthritis, 68 weeks, reported in December 2025: weight down 26.4 and 28.7 percent at 9 and 12 mg against 2.1 on placebo, and WOMAC knee pain down 4.5 and 4.4 points against 2.4, so placebo captured more than half the pain response. In July 2026 TRIUMPH-2 in type 2 diabetes reported 20.8 percent at 12 mg, TRIUMPH-3 in severe obesity with cardiovascular disease up to 22.6 percent. The TRIUMPH-1 sleep apnoea basket reported the apnoea-hypopnoea index falling by up to 36.1 events an hour, 60.6 percent from a baseline of 58.6, with no placebo figure in the announcement.

None of those four has a peer reviewed publication or posted registry results. The only peer reviewed phase 3 paper is TRANSCEND-T2D-1 in the Lancet, 537 people with type 2 diabetes over 40 weeks, 15.3 percent weight reduction at 12 mg on the treatment regimen estimand. A press release is not a publication: no tables, no confidence intervals, no adverse event list, no external review. The headline cannot be interrogated.

The plateau question is real. The phase 2 authors flagged that weight had not plateaued at 48 weeks, and week 80 to week 104 corroborates it, so the curve is still descending wherever it has been measured and the asymptote is unknown. That is not the same as continuing indefinitely. Hepatic fat is the contrast: it plateaus near maximally by week 24, at about 20 percent weight loss, on a stated floor effect.

The liver data, and its two ceilings

In the MASLD substudy, 98 people with liver fat of 10 percent or more by MRI, relative liver fat fell 82.4 percent at 12 mg at 24 weeks, a difference against placebo of 82.7 percent, 95 percent confidence interval 95.2 to 70.2. Liver fat below 5 percent was reached by 86 percent of that arm at 24 weeks and 93 percent at 48 weeks.

Two qualifiers matter more. No participant in any retatrutide trial has had a liver biopsy, so resolution of steatosis on imaging is not resolution of steatohepatitis, and 48 week MRI data were missing for 56.1 percent of the substudy. The authors call it hypothesis generating, not definitive.

Safety, with denominators

In TRIUMPH-1 at 12 mg, nausea occurred in 42.4 percent against 14.8 on placebo and vomiting in 25.3 against 4.8. Dysesthesia, an altered or unpleasant sensation, occurred in 5.1, 12.3 and 12.5 percent at 4, 9 and 12 mg against 0.9 percent on placebo. That is roughly fourteen times the placebo rate, it is absent from the phase 2 record, and no mechanism has been published for it.

Discontinuation because of adverse events tracks dose. TRIUMPH-1: 4.1, 6.9 and 11.3 percent against 4.9 on placebo. TRIUMPH-3: 9.8 and 13.5 against 4.8. TRIUMPH-4: 12.2 and 18.2 against 4.0, the highest in the programme, in an older population with joint disease and no 4 mg arm.

In phase 2, heart rate rose by up to 6.7 beats per minute, peaking at 24 weeks and declining afterwards. No heart rate data have been reported for any of the four phase 3 obesity trials, although pulse is collected across the programme per the design paper. The data exist and are unreported, which for a drug given 80 weeks is itself a finding.

Regulatory status

Retatrutide is not approved by any regulator anywhere, and no marketing application has been filed. The sponsor said in July 2026 that it plans to submit a Biologics License Application to FDA in the first quarter of 2027, a target that had already slipped because more manufacturing and quality control data were needed. A submission is not a review, and a review is not an approval.

No breakthrough therapy, fast track, priority review, orphan or PRIME designation is documented in any source located. That is a statement about the documents, not a claim that none exists.

A pre-approval expanded access programme exists and is narrow: physician initiated, for a BMI of 35 or more with two or more serious or life-threatening obesity-related complications, documented failure at the highest dose of an approved therapy, no accessible trial, and a prior discussion of all standard options including bariatric surgery. It is supply limited, and it is not availability.

What circulates, and why no numbers appear here

This site does not reproduce the circulating retatrutide figures, because the compound is unapproved, the harm sits in the escalation rather than the molecule, and the vials have been shown not to hold what the label says.

Product identity is the most useful fact here. Eighteen samples sold as retatrutide in Australia were tested in 2026. One matched its label. About 30 percent were more concentrated than labelled, about 30 percent less. One vial contained none of the peptide at all. The peptide typically made up only about 10 percent of the vial contents, leaving, in the analytical chemist’s words, another 90 per cent that is unaccounted for, which could contain a different toxin or something else unsafe. These figures come from the reported testing, because the primary publication was not retrievable.

Over-concentration was as common as dilution, which inverts the usual assumption that sellers cut to save money. For a molecule with a six day half life and dose-dependent adverse events, being unknowingly above the intended amount is the worse error. A purity certificate does not address it: purity and content are different measurements.

In a letter to the Federation of State Medical Boards dated 2 April 2025, FDA cautioned against unapproved products containing retatrutide that are being sold directly to consumers, often with false labeling and dosing instructions, and stated that compounded retatrutide products do not currently meet the requirements for exemptions under sections 503A or 503B of the Federal Food, Drug, and Cosmetic Act. Having no USP or NF monograph and not being a component of an approved drug product, it fails both pathways. A warning letter of 31 March 2026 established that a not-for-human-consumption disclaimer is no shield.

On the reported death, three clauses belong together or none do. One death has been reported in the United Kingdom, and the MHRA has logged 77 suspected adverse reaction reports. A suspected report is a suspicion, not a finding, and causation has not been established. And the exposure denominator is unquantified: given the testing above, nobody knows how many of those people received retatrutide, or how much.

What the record gets wrong

Three times as effective as semaglutide. No head to head trial against semaglutide in obesity exists. The only registered comparison, TRANSCEND-T2D-2, is in type 2 diabetes and open label. Every ratio in circulation is arithmetic across separate trials differing in duration, population and estimand. TRIUMPH-5, the only head to head against tirzepatide, reports in November 2026.

Retatrutide beat tirzepatide. Like for like on estimand, TRIUMPH-1 at 12 mg was 25.0 percent at week 80 and SURMOUNT-1 at 15 mg was 20.9 percent at week 72. The usual presentation, 28.3 against 20.9, sets an on-treatment analysis against an intention to treat one and makes the gap look about 80 percent larger than it is. It also omits the discontinuation figures, which run the other way.

Retatrutide is being studied in heart failure with preserved ejection fraction. There is no such trial. Heart failure appears only as one component of the TRIUMPH-Outcomes composite, as an adjudicated safety event and as an exclusion criterion. The claim was almost certainly imported from tirzepatide.

The problem is not confined to vendor pages. A 2025 review in Biomolecules says the phase 2 obesity trial used doses up to 8 mg; it used 12 mg, and the same paragraph then reports the 12 mg results correctly. A 2026 review in Cardiology in Review gives a 23.2 percent fat mass reduction as though it came from the obesity trial. It comes from the DXA substudy of the type 2 diabetes trial, it is not the maximum, because the pooled 8 mg arm reached 26.1 percent, and the same sentence calls it comparable to bariatric surgery with no comparator in the cited data. Go to the trial publication and the registry record, never to a review, for any number.

What is not known

Its molecular weight. Figures circulate in chemical catalogues, but no primary publication or regulatory document names one, so none is asserted here.

Whether it prevents anything. No cardiovascular or kidney outcome data exist. TRIUMPH-Outcomes, 10,000 participants across 743 sites, has a primary completion date of February 2029. Blood pressure, lipoproteins and inflammatory markers all move favourably and heart rate moves unfavourably, and none of those is an outcome.

What happens when it stops. The entire published record is one sentence in the MASLD substudy noting some weight regain at the safety follow-up four weeks after discontinuation, which for a molecule with a six day half life is less than five half lives. TRIUMPH-6, the randomised withdrawal trial, reports in April 2028. Until then, claims that losses are durable and claims that regain is rapid are equally unsupported for this molecule.

What the liver findings mean histologically. No participant in any retatrutide trial has had a liver biopsy. The hepatic data are MRI fat fraction and serum biomarkers, the substudy population was not enriched for steatohepatitis or significant fibrosis, and the phase 3 liver outcomes trial reports in August 2030.

What happens to muscle in people without diabetes. The only published body composition data come from a type 2 diabetes substudy in which 103 of 189 participants contributed paired scans, and the authors’ conclusion is about the proportion of lean mass lost, not absolute sparing. Because total weight loss is larger, a similar proportion means a larger absolute loss. The only DXA substudy in the phase 3 obesity programme sits inside TRIUMPH-3 and is unreported, and no muscle strength, grip, gait speed or physical function endpoint appears anywhere in the programme.

Anything about bone. There is no bone mineral density endpoint, no fracture endpoint and no bone turnover marker in any registered retatrutide trial, in any species. Native GIP induces osteoblast activity, which is a reason to expect benefit, and weight loss of 25 to 30 percent is itself associated with bone loss, which is a reason to expect harm. Which dominates has not been tested.

Why dysesthesia occurs in 12.5 percent of participants at 12 mg. No mechanism has been proposed in any source located, and the event is absent from the phase 2 record.

Anything in the populations every trial excluded: type 1 diabetes, anyone under 18, pregnancy and lactation, advanced fibrosis or cirrhosis, prior bariatric surgery, a history of pancreatitis, and anyone who had taken another weight loss drug within 90 days, which means no switching, add-on or sequencing data exist at all.

No dose of retatrutide has been established as safe or effective, because no regulator has reviewed the compound and no marketing application has been filed. What follows is a record of what trials administered, not an instruction.

The phase 2 obesity trial, NCT04881760, randomised 338 adults across seven arms to 1 mg, 4 mg, 8 mg or 12 mg once weekly for 48 weeks, or placebo. The 4 mg and 8 mg maintenance doses each appeared twice, differing only in whether the starting dose was 2 mg or 4 mg. The 2 mg start produced fewer gastrointestinal events at the same maintenance dose, and in the parallel phase 2 type 2 diabetes trial the fast escalation 8 mg arm had the highest gastrointestinal rate in the study at 50 percent while achieving no better result than the slow escalation arm.

The phase 3 TRIUMPH trials used maintenance doses of 4, 9 and 12 mg once weekly, or 9 and 12 mg only in TRIUMPH-3 and TRIUMPH-4, reached through what the design paper calls a fixed dose escalation regimen lasting 16 weeks, followed by 64 weeks of maintenance. The weekly step sizes inside that 16 weeks have never been published. TRANSCEND-CKD did not use a fixed dose at all, titrating to the maximum tolerated dose up to 12 mg.

The trials also attached things to the dose that no circulating schedule carries: permitted permanent dose reduction for gastrointestinal events after a de-escalation and re-escalation attempt, permitted reduction for anyone reaching a BMI of 22 or lower or who felt they had lost too much weight, and discontinuation at a BMI of 18.5 or lower.

Which escalation scheme is best is an open question the sponsor is still studying. TRIUMPH-9, 600 participants over 104 weeks, exists to compare escalation schemes and reports in October 2028.
